X @Investopedia
Investopedia· 2025-08-04 14:00
A moving average (MA) is a technical indicator that smooths price action by filtering out noise. SMAs average all prices equally; EMAs give more weight to recent prices. Learn more: https://t.co/GQlDXDb2n7 https://t.co/iywWV5KgUu ...
